1990 Alfa Romeo Spider vs. 1974 Toyota Sprinter
To start off, 1990 Alfa Romeo Spider is newer by 16 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1974 Toyota Sprinter.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1974 Toyota Sprinter would be higher. At 1,962 cc (4 cylinders), 1990 Alfa Romeo Spider is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1990 Alfa Romeo Spider (124 HP) has 64 more horse power than 1974 Toyota Sprinter. (60 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1990 Alfa Romeo Spider should accelerate faster than 1974 Toyota Sprinter.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1990 Alfa Romeo Spider weights approximately 305 kg more than 1974 Toyota Sprinter.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 1990 Alfa Romeo Spider (166 Nm @ 4200 RPM) has 69 more torque (in Nm) than 1974 Toyota Sprinter. (97 Nm @ 3800 RPM). This means 1990 Alfa Romeo Spider will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1974 Toyota Sprinter.
Compare all specifications:
1990 Alfa Romeo Spider | 1974 Toyota Sprinter |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Toyota |
Model | Spider | Sprinter |
Year Released | 1990 | 1974 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1962 cc | 1166 cc |
Horse Power | 124 HP | 60 HP |
Torque | 166 Nm | 97 Nm |
Torque RPM | 4200 RPM | 3800 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 4 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1145 kg | 840 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4250 mm | 4000 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1640 mm | 1580 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1300 mm | 1360 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2260 mm | 2380 mm |
